OPERATING INSTRUCTIONS RH 40 F Repair work Connecting the jumper cables " Connect the red jumper cable to the positive pole of the empty battery (1,Fig. 4-1:), then to the positive pole of the charged battery (2). " Connect the black jumper cable first to the negative pole of the charged battery (3), then to the negative pole of the empty battery (4). Explosion hazard When the negative terminal is connected to ground, a strong current flows through the jumper cable.
Starting up the engine " Start up the engines of the supplying machine and run at high speed. " Start up the engine of the receiving machine. If the engine fails to start up after 15 seconds, wait for one minute and thenstart again. " When the engine has started up, continue running both machines in no-load operation for about two or three minutes with the jumper cables still connected.
